Overview
SESTRIERE_MOLINO is a secondary wastewater treatment plant in Sestriere, Piemonte, Italy, serving 2,469 people. It has a designed capacity of 3,000 m³/day and discharges 509 m³/day of treated effluent.
SESTRIERE_MOLINO is a municipal wastewater treatment plant located in Sestriere, a town in the Piemonte region of northwestern Italy. The plant serves a population of 2,469 and is situated in the Alpine environment of the Susa Valley, near the French border. The plant provides secondary treatment, which is the standard required by the EU Urban Waste Water Treatment Directive (91/271/EEC) for agglomerations of this size. Its designed capacity is 3,000 m³/day, with an average daily discharge of 509 m³/day, indicating significant reserve capacity. The treated effluent is discharged into local watercourses that drain into the Dora Riparia river, a tributary of the Po River. The Po River flows eastward across northern Italy to the Adriatic Sea. The plant's operation helps protect the sensitive Alpine watershed and downstream ecosystems.
